Here are some habits of successful teachers:
- They know their content inside out — Successful teachers are experts in their content area. They know the material inside and out, and they can answer any question their students may ask.
- Create a positive learning environment — A positive learning environment is essential for student success. Successful teachers make sure their classroom is a safe place where students feel comfortable taking risks and making mistakes.
- Use a variety of teaching strategies — Successful teachers know that not all students learn the same way. Teachers generally use a variety of teaching strategies to reach all of their students.
- They are constantly learning — Successful teachers never stop learning. They keep up with the latest research and trends in education, and they continually find new ways to improve their teaching practice.
- Connect with families — Successful teachers build strong relationships with the families of their students. They communicate regularly with parents, and they work together to help students succeed both in and out of the classroom.
- Develop meaningful relationships with their students — Successful teachers develop meaningful relationships with their students. They get to know their students on a personal level, and they work hard to build trust and rapport.
- Make learning fun — Successful teachers know that if students aren’t enjoying themselves, they won’t learn. They use a variety of strategies to make learning fun and engaging, and they find ways to connect the material to students’ lives.
- Reflective practitioners — Successful teachers are reflective practitioners. They constantly evaluate their teaching practice, and they use feedback to make improvements.
Most importantly, Successful teachers stay healthy both mentally and physically. They get enough sleep, eat a balanced diet, and exercise regularly.

Here are some of the healthiest habits of successful teachers:
- They get enough sleep — This may seem like a no-brainer, but many teachers do not get enough sleep. They often stay up late grading papers or preparing for the next day’s lesson. However, getting enough sleep is crucial for optimal performance.
- Exercise regularly — A healthy body leads to a healthy mind. Teachers who exercise regularly have more energy and are less stressed.
- They eat healthily — Teachers are often on the go and don’t have time to stop for a break, let alone eat a nutritious meal. However, eating healthy is important for maintaining energy levels and focus.
- Take breaks — Despite being busy, successful teachers still make time for breaks. They use this time to relax their mind and body, which in turn helps them stay focused and productive.
- They stay organized — One of the keys to being a successful teacher is staying organized. This includes having a plan for each day, keeping track of student assignments, and using effective classroom management techniques.
- They take care of themselves mentally and emotionally — Teaching can be a challenging profession. Successful teachers take care of themselves mentally and emotionally by building positive relationships with colleagues, seeking support when needed, and taking time for themselves.
